Join a Dave’s Eats Hobart walking tour and sink your teeth into the delicious flavours of Tasmania’s capital. This guided foodie adventure takes you through Hobart’s scenic waterfront and vibrant streets, stopping to sample the best local bites along the way. From award-winning cheeses and deli meats to fresh-off-the-boat seafood, handmade chocolates, and creamy local ice cream, every stop offers something uniquely Tasmanian. Visit family-run fishmongers, charming bakeries, and passionate producers while hearing the tasty tales behind each treat. Sample Itinerary changes venues regularly, so the below is a sample itinerary only after meeting the guide, its a short walk for some Tassie seafood shortly followed by an iconic Tasmanian curried scallop pie Next, head to a deli for a tasting plate of deli meats made in house along with local cheeses and a chat with the owner and/or butcher follow this up with some locally made chocolate with liquid Tassie booze inside (under 18’s will be given something else).The tour heads across the waterfront to a family run fishmonger and restaurant to see whats fresh and to try some fresh local oysters at the very least. A little piece of Jam dount in an old jam factory is the penultimate treat. The tour finishes with some ice cream by the waterfront from a floating punt. Recommend the uniquely Tasmanian flavour which you’ll taste but we leave the ice cream choice up to you. Leave the Dave’s East Hobart Food Tour having tasted a wide variety of Hobartian delights, a full belly and an ice cream in your hand!
